So, for example, while #color(red)(847.13)xx10^color(blue)(1)# is in scientific notation (with a mantissa of #847.13#) it is not in standard scientific notation which would be #color(red)(8.4713)xx10^color(blue)(3)#. In standard scientific notation, the mantissa is always written with one non-zero digit to the left of the decimal point. Definition of Octal Number SystemĪ number system with base 8 is called an octal number system. So, it has fewer calculations and thereby less calculation errors. The main advantage of using the octal number system is that it uses fewer digits than the decimal and hexadecimal number system. That means there are only 8 symbols or digits (0, 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7) used to form other numbers. The octal numeral system is the base-8 number system, and uses the digits 0 to 7.
